Transaction 5637b86bf7da92fadd1db63b728e2ca2a7bcf0fe7d4840d75f47f58befa27506
1 Input
1 Output
-
5637b86bf7da92fadd1db63b728e2ca2a7bcf0fe7d4840d75f47f58befa27506:0
- value
- 1452333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f879775caf2e8d882f5c9878e8b52b05669e3a04 OP_EQUAL
- address
- 3QLq1jwrS3Nua78S1EZynGMRPG8y3MToTa